Есть ли программа для автоматической установки всех моих дисков?

57

Иногда, когда я перезагружаю компьютер, мои диски монтируются, но иногда они не будут (как сейчас, когда я набираю этот вопрос).

Есть ли простой способ, как программа, которая может установить их для меня? Переход на консоль, создание папок и т. Д. НЕ является тем, что я хочу. Мне нравится, как Windows делает это там, где они всегда монтируют диски независимо от того, что.

Если нет программы, как еще я могу легко смонтировать все диски?

    
задан Jryl 23.03.2013 в 13:09
источник

4 ответа

82

Это работает в 12.10 - 16.10

Введите Диски в тире, и вы получите:

Нажмите значок маленькой шестерни, чтобы получить подменю, и выберите «Изменить параметры монтирования». После этого вы увидите:

Измените параметры автоматического монтирования в положение ON. сделайте это для всех дисков, которые вам нужно установить при запуске.

Примечание. Будьте осторожны с тем, что вы изменяете, это может привести к неправильной работе системы.

    
ответ дан Mitch 23.03.2013 в 13:29
источник
14

Как автоматически монтировать части / диски NTFS в Ubuntu

Нажмите кнопку Ubuntu, запустите приложение disks .

выберите раздел NTFS / диск? Нажмите кнопку конфигурации, выберите Edit Mount Options...

Поверните off Automatic Mount Options , select Mount at startup . выберите Display Name Like Data или partition-Data или seriously-not-porn , в зависимости от того, что лучше всего описывает вашу личность?!

Mount Point означает, где вы хотите его монтировать! это может быть /mnt/DATA//home/username/part-data или /home/username/Videos/no-porno снова, что лучше всего описывает вашу личность! После этого Нажмите «ОК», введите свой пароль, снова ОК. и перезагрузите систему, и увидите установленный HardDiskdrive.

Источник

ответ дан blade19899 26.05.2013 в 22:47
4

Если вы хотите сделать это по собственному сценарию (без использования какой-либо программы), то вам может помочь следующее:

Создайте файл с именем automount в /usr/local/bin и дайте ему разрешение на выполнение ( sudo chmod +x ).

  • case-1: sudo without password (Если вы установили NOPASSWD в /etc/sudoers : -)

    Содержание для /usr/local/bin/automount :

    #!/bin/bash
    cd /dev/disk/by-label
    for label in *
    do
        partition=$(basename $(readlink $label))
        sudo mkdir /media/$USER/$label
        sudo mount /dev/$partition /media/$USER/$label
    done
    exit
    

    Затем создайте Strartup Application ( gnome-session-properties ) и добавьте следующее:

  • case-2: sudo требуется пароль (если вы не установили NOPASSWD в /etc/sudoers ): -

    Содержание для /usr/local/bin/automount :

    #!/bin/bash
    cd /dev/disk/by-label
    user=$(zenity --entry --text="Enter Username")
    for label in *
    do
        partition=$(basename $(readlink $label))
        sudo mkdir /media/$user/$label
        sudo mount /dev/$partition /media/$user/$label
    done
    exit
    

    В качестве альтернативы вы можете установить <username> навсегда вместо $user .

    Затем создайте Приложение Strartup ( gnome-session-properties ) и добавьте следующее:

    Примечание. Для запуска gksudo пакет gksu . Если сначала не делать: sudo apt-get install gksu

Дополнительные примечания:

  • Этот скрипт монтирует разделы на /media/$USER/<Disk-Label> .

  • Чтобы проверить / изменить метки вашего раздела, вы можете использовать gnome-disk-utility :

ответ дан Pandya 06.03.2015 в 08:05
1

В окне «Параметры монтирования» обязательно используйте UNCHECK параметр «Показать в пользовательском интерфейсе», если вы вносите изменения с помощью этой утилиты. Существует KNOWN BUG , который может привести к сбою установки и даже сделать система не загружается, если вы используете утилиту DISKS, чтобы изменить эти параметры и оставить «Показать в пользовательском интерфейсе».

Эта ошибка будет отображаться как заявляющая, что commend «x-gvfs-show» не распознается или что отсутствует параметр при попытке монтировать этот раздел.

    
ответ дан HoustonDave 24.10.2014 в 15:36